Here are the main considerations to keep in mind:Massage Modes and Intensity
Look for models that offer multiple massage modes such as kneading, rolling, or vibration. The ability to adjust intensity is also crucial, as it allows customization based on your foot sensitivity and relief needs. Overly aggressive settings can be uncomfortable, while too gentle may be ineffective. Choosing a device with a variety of options ensures you can find the perfect level of comfort and therapeutic benefit without compromise.
Heat Functionality
Heat enhances relaxation and improves circulation, making it a key feature in these devices. Consider adjustable temperature settings to match your comfort level, especially if you have sensitive skin or circulation issues. Some models offer consistent warmth, while others allow you to control the heat intensity, which can be a significant advantage for prolonged use or specific conditions like plantar fasciitis.
Size and Portability
Foot spas come in various sizes, from large, fixed units to collapsible, portable models. Larger devices often provide more extensive massage coverage and stability but can be cumbersome to store. Collapsible options excel for those with limited space or who want to move the device easily. Consider your storage space and whether portability is a priority to select the best size for your home setup.
Ease of Use and Controls
Intuitive controls, such as touchscreen interfaces or simple dials, make daily use more straightforward. Some models include remote controls or timers, adding convenience. Avoid overly complicated interfaces if you prefer quick, hassle-free operation. Ease of cleaning and maintenance is also important for long-term use, especially with removable liners or easy-to-access components.
Additional Therapeutic Features
Extras like red light therapy, ozone infusion, or infrared light can boost the therapeutic effects, targeting issues like inflammation or poor circulation. While these features add value, they also tend to increase the price and complexity. Consider whether these enhancements align with your health goals and budget, and prioritize models that include the features most important to you.
Frequently Asked Questions
Can I use a heated foot massager every day?
Most heated foot massagers are designed for regular use, and many users find daily sessions beneficial for circulation and relaxation. However, paying attention to your comfort and any underlying health conditions is key. If you have diabetes, circulatory problems, or foot injuries, consult your healthcare provider before frequent use. Using the device as directed and avoiding extended sessions beyond the manufacturer’s recommendations can help prevent irritation or discomfort.
Are collapsible foot spas as effective as larger, fixed models?
Collapsible foot spas generally provide similar basic functions like heat and massage but may have less extensive massage coverage or fewer features due to size constraints. They are ideal for those with limited space or who need portability, but might lack the power or variety of modes found in larger units. For casual relaxation or occasional use, collapsible models can be a practical and effective choice. For frequent, intensive therapy, a larger, more feature-rich unit might be better.
What maintenance is required for these devices?
Maintenance typically involves regular cleaning of removable liners, nozzles, or massage rollers to prevent buildup of dirt, oils, or bacteria. Using mild cleaning agents and following the manufacturer’s instructions prolongs the device’s lifespan. Some models have washable components, making upkeep easier. Avoid submerging electronic parts and ensure the device is unplugged during cleaning to maintain safety and performance.
